Job Description Details:

A. The primary objective of this service is to maintain the current Tableau Server Dev, Qual, and Production environments in alignment with our processes, standards, and governance. This service must also provide primary administration, support, and knowledgebase for our enterprise implementation and assist ITSD leadership in collaboration with business stakeholders to plan and execute an ITSD center of excellence capable of proper ongoing development, delivery, as well as support for this platform.

B. This Tableau Expert(s) must perform all four tiers of system administration and support tasks for our eight (8) core internally hosted Tableau instance and new role-based Tableau instance that includes: 1) Corrective Maintenance and Incident Management, 2) System Software Upgrades and Preventative Maintenance, 3) Tableau Development & Enhancements to optimize business uses of Tableau, and 4) Provide Guidance, Insight, and Recommendations to create new Tableau analytical strategies.

C. The contractor must provide these specific components:
1. Perform server upgrades, maintain server settings, software application patches, software user maintenance and enhancement, backup and restore, etc.
2. Provide end user incident and non-incident support.
3. Provide User creation, User permissions and provisioning.
4. Provide mission critical production support of Tableau for all Department end users and were applicable data for select external users and some public uses.
5. Complete performance tuning and server management of Tableau server environment (clustering, load balancing).
6. Evaluate and maximize server and data source optimization.
7. Work with data architects, SMEs and Power Users in setting up environments that meet the needs of users.
8. Ensure application of enterprise-required security controls for Tableau functionality in collaboration with IT Security and Compliance teams to ensure maximum compliance to Department policy while minimizing security risks and maximizing end user functionality.
9. Ensure best in class tools are being used for monitoring and performance tuning.
10. Troubleshoot and optimize Tableau dashboards/workbooks and data refreshes.
11. Provide change management for Tableau upgrade schedules, releases, and new features.
12. Collaborate with advanced Tableau users to create and implement Platform governance and standards around data sources, transformations, dashboards, and sharing of best practices to all Department users.
13. Work with Tableau or other Tableau third-party expertise to implement, modify, or improve the Tableau implementation and Tableau eco-system.
14. Provide knowledge transfers as deemed appropriate to support Tableau Enterprise sustainability.
